Abstract: Four unprecedented C17-pseudoguaianolides with extended side chains, hookerolides A–D (1–4), were isolated from the whole plants of Inula hookeri. Their structures and absolute configurations were elucidated by a combination of NMR spectroscopy, CD spectrum, and the modified Mosher method. The in vitro bioactivity evaluation suggested that 1–4 possessed moderate to weak anti-inflammatory and cytotoxic properties. [Copyright &y& Elsevier] |
